    This is hands down the worst hotel I have ever been in. The door looks kicked in. Brown mold on shower curtain liner, king bed pushed up to wall between two full size wall attached headboards, no fridge, rotting wood around doors and dated decor with matted down water damaged carpeting under the AC unit. Additionally the office employee let himself in our room at 10:30 pm and argued with us when we cancelled 2 nights from our 3 night stay stating there was a 3 night minimum. A nightmarish experience. Do NOT be deceived by the photos online the rooms look nothing like the photos. Here are pix of our room.

    This place is a dump. See attached photos. I can't believe we paid $200 a night for this. The rooms are in serious need of repairs and/or updates. The walls are paper thin so you can hear the conversations in neighboring rooms, not to mention the television audio. The walls have visible water damage, peeling paint and even open and I repaired holes. The bathroom had mold, chipped tiles, peeling paint and rusty hinges. All the base boards were removed and all they did was paint over them. Both stairs to head up to the second floor were shaky/rickety. All the floors are chipped. The one positive? We did not encounter bed bugs or roaches, however, we were only in this room for a grand total of 9 hours (11 pm - 8 am). STAY AWAY!

    We stayed here because it was close to the dive center we were taking a course at. Here's how it…read morewent: The Good: - The room was clean and had everything you needed for an easy night. Ours had a stove, microwave, and full fridge along with dishes. Not all the rooms have this so if you want it make sure you check. - Provided beach towels - Provided soaps and shampoos - Parking right next to room is available though first come first serve - Private beach with kayaks available and a pier - The decor throughout the resort was beach themed and fun - Breakfast included, but see below... - Located near lots of food options The Not So Good: - Breakfast didn't start until around 7:30. This was too late for us to use since we had to be at the dive center at that time. So if you have early plans, get your own breakfast somewhere else - Breakfast is very small with limited options. Get breakfast somewhere else - Hard beds - While most things are well maintained it did not hide the slightly run-down appearance of some things - Little expensive for what you actually get. I understand it is on a limited space key, and it is a tourist town, but it was still more like a motel and should have been priced accordingly Bottom Line: Good enough place to stay and it was convenient, but be careful of the price and bring your own food.
